Dear Ebrahime,

PIE (Pocket Internet Explorer) available in Windows Mobile 5.0, 6.0, 6.1 does not support all WebDynpro elements. Or in other words, the SAP GUI for HTML which is being used in your case here does not support PIE. You may have to use ITS Mobile or have a service which will direct to a WebDynpro app (which uses elements supported by PIE).
